    Hi guys,

    I'm working on the 1.2 update to Double Maze.

    The biggest feature is the level editor with the ability to upload and share your creations.

    Here is a video of it in action. This is a development build and is liable to change.

    [hqyoutube]-OM73-4UwyA[/hqyoutube]

    Is there anything you guys would like to see in 1.2?
